思迅软件作为一款广泛应用于零售、餐饮等行业的信息化管理系统,其数据库的备份工作显得尤为重要
本文将详细介绍如何高效备份思迅数据库,以确保企业数据的安全无忧
一、备份前的准备工作 在正式进行数据库备份之前,我们需要做一些必要的准备工作,以确保备份过程的顺利进行和数据的安全性
1.评估备份需求: - 根据企业的业务需求和数据重要性,确定备份的频率(如每日、每周或每月)和备份类型(如全量备份、增量备份或差异备份)
- 考虑是否需要异地备份,以防止自然灾害或单点故障导致的数据丢失
2.选择合适的备份工具: - 思迅软件通常支持多种数据库备份工具,如Sybase Central(针对Sybase数据库)、SQL Server Management Studio(针对SQL Server数据库)等
- 根据所使用的数据库类型,选择合适的备份工具,并确保备份工具与数据库版本的兼容性
3.配置备份存储: - 确定备份文件的存储位置,可以是本地磁盘、网络存储设备或云端存储
- 确保备份存储的可靠性和冗余性,以防止备份数据丢失
二、备份方法详解 根据思迅软件所使用的数据库类型,以下将分别介绍Sybase数据库和SQL Server数据库的备份方法
1. Sybase数据库备份方法 Sybase数据库备份通常使用dump命令和load命令来完成
以下是具体的备份步骤: 全量备份数据库: sql dump database database_name to dump_device with init 其中,`database_name`是你要备份的数据库名称,`dump_device`是备份设备的名称或路径
`withinit`选项表示初始化备份设备,覆盖之前的备份内容
备份事务日志: sql dump transaction database_name to dump_device with truncate_only `with truncate_only`选项表示仅截断事务日志,不备份日志内容
在实际操作中,可能需要根据具体需求选择是否包含此选项
恢复数据库: 在需要恢复数据库时,可以使用load命令
例如: sql load database database_name from dump_device 确保在恢复前,已经正确配置了数据库设备和数据库结构
此外,还可以使用Sybase Central图形界面工具进行备份操作
具体步骤如下: 1. 打开Sybase Central,连接到需要备份的数据库服务器
2. 使用管理员账户登录,并启动备份服务器
3. 选择需要备份的数据库,右键点击选择“Backup”命令
4. 在弹出的备份对话框中,选择备份类型(全量备份或事务日志备份),并指定备份设备
5. 点击“OK”开始备份过程
2. SQL Server数据库备份方法 对于使用SQL Server作为数据库的思迅软件,备份过程通常通过SQL Server Management Studio(SSMS)来完成
以下是具体的备份步骤: 全量备份数据库: 1. 打开SSMS并连接到SQL Server实例
2. 在对象资源管理器中,右键点击要备份的数据库,选择“任务”->“备份”
3. 在弹出的备份数据库对话框中,选择备份类型为“完整”,并指定备份目标(如磁盘文件)
4. 设置好备份路径和文件名后,点击“确定”开始备份过程
差异备份或增量备份: 根据需要,可以选择差异备份或增量备份来减少备份时间和存储空间
差异备份备份自上次全量备份以来发生变化的数据,而增量备份则备份自上次备份(无论是全量还是差异)以来发生变化的数据
恢复数据库: 在需要恢复数据库时,可以使用SSMS中的“还原数据库”功能
具体步骤如下: 1. 在对象资源管理器中,右键点击“数据库”,选择“还原数据库”
2. 在弹出的还原数据库对话框中,选择“源设备”,并浏览找到之前备份的文件
3. 在“选择用于还原的备份集”中勾选要还原的备份,并设置还原选项
4. 点击“确定”开始还原过程
三、备份策略与最佳实践 为了确保数据库备份的有效性和可靠性,我们需要制定合适的备份策略并遵循最佳实践
1.定期备份: - 设置自动化定时备份程序,确保数据的常态备份
建议每日至少进行一次全量备份,并根据业务需求进行增量或差异备份
2.多地备份: - 将备份数据分布在多个地点存储,如本地磁盘、网络存储设备和云端存储
这样可以防止单点故障和自然灾害导致的数据丢失
3.冷备份与热备份: - 根据业务需求和实施成本,选择合适的备份方式
冷备份在系统关闭或非高峰时段进行,对业务影响较小;热备份在系统正常运行时进行,但可能对业务性能产生一定影响
4.备份验证与恢复演练: - 定期验证备份数据的完整性和可用性
通过恢复演练来确保在需要时能够快速、准确地恢复数据库
5.加密与安全性: - 对备份数据进行加密处理,确保在传输和存储过程中的安全性
同时,加强备份存储的访问控制,防止非法访问和数据泄露
6.灾难恢复计划: - 制定应急预案和灾难恢复计划,明确在发生数据丢失或系统故障时的恢复流程和责任分工
确保在紧急情况下能够迅速响应并恢复数据和系统功能
四、总结与展望 数据库备份是企业信息化管理中不可或缺的一环
对于使用思迅软件的企业而言,高效、可靠的数据库备份不仅能够保障数据的完整性和安全性,还能提高企业的运营效率和风险抵御能力
通过选择合适的备份工具、制定合适的备份策略并遵循最佳实践,我们可以确保思迅数据库的安全无忧
未来,随着技术的不断发展和业务需求的变化,我们还需要不断探索和创新备份技术与方法,以适应新的挑战和机遇